    I haven't eaten at 2M Smokehouse in many years. I got there right before they opened up and there was a small line. After they opened up,I was served in about ten minutes or so. I got some fatty brisket,pork belly,one link of pork sausage and an 8oz size side of the mac & cheese. All that was a little over $40 before tip. BBQ isn't cheap,but worth it if it's good! The brisket was flavorful and tender like Texas bbq should be. The pork belly was delicious and the pork sausage was very good. The pork sausage had cheese and serrano peppers in it,but it wasn't very spicy. The mac & cheese had good flavor but was very cheesy. The people working there were very friendly and helpful. I like the new look inside. 2M Smokehouse is still the best BBQ joint in San Antonio in my opinion. When you are on the Southeast side of town,make sure to stop by 2M for some amazing bbq.

    2M Smokehouse, famous for their unique BBQ and sides caught my attention since its inception. Arrived on a Friday around lunch time and to my surprise the line was right up to the door. The place is a hole in the wall and has character very made from scratch feel and as you wait in line you study the menu and notice that once your up they fulfill your order as you place it which is standard in a traditional bbq place. I ordered the 1/2 pound of brisket, 1/2 pound of pork ribs, a pork sausage link, their special spaghetti verde and esquite corn Mexican corn style all which comes to about $60 to feed 2 people which isn't bad. The place is small inside however if you brave the summer heat there are plenty of seating outside. Let's review the FOOD, the brisket was nice and flavorful didn't need any BBQ sauce at all, juicy and easy to pull apart and also not very much fat which is plus! The pork ribs are amazing, a bit too much rub for my taste otherwise cooked to perfection! The pork sausage was packed with flavor, filled with pork of course, Oaxaca cheese, and Serrano peppers gave it a good kick. The meat complemented well with creamy, cheesy and spicy Mexican corn and the green spaghetti verde had a nice flavor to it. All in all for the price, BBQ and sides this place is by far the best BBQ I've had in San Antonio. I'll be sure to return, it's no wonder the owners here have been chosen to be in Food Network's Pitmaster's!

    Tried 2M Smokehouse and honestly... I don't really get the hype. The brisket was great -- and for the prices they charge, it better be. Portions were solid, and the homemade-style pickles were actually really good too. But a lot of the rest was disappointing. They have an hour wait was brutal especially when many items started falling off the menu, what's the time I was waiting on the outside The meat came out cold, and the sandwich was insanely salty to the point where it was hard to finish. The BBQ sauce was super sweet and thin, and honestly made things worse instead of better. They were also out of a ton of menu items and most of the sides. Only mac and cheese was left, and after trying it... I kind of understood why. They put pork rind dust on top, which caught me off guard since. The pulled pork had salsa verde and cilantro mixed into it. Maybe it would've been better hot, but I personally wasn't a fan of that flavor combo for BBQ. The brisket nachos sounded amazing because of the Oaxaca cheese, but it honestly felt unnecessary and kind of a crime against good brisket. Overall, it feels like they're trying really hard to be different instead of just focusing on making consistently great Texas BBQ. There are definitely better BBQ spots in San Antonio in my opinion. If you go, go right when they open so the food is fresh, hot, and they still have the full menu available. Also, the inside seating area is really small. The parking lot is a mess alone, it rained the night before, so literally my entire tire was underwater in the parking lot . If it's packed, honestly come back another day because standing outside in the Texas heat while eating super salty BBQ sounds like a recipe for heat stroke.
